
The Income Tax Department has issued a tax notice of Rs 62.34 billion to Bharat Sanchar Nigam Limited for under-reporting its income in 2011-12. BSNL had reported revenues of 279.33 billion in 2011-12, a decline of six per cent over revenues of Rs 296.87 billion in 2010-11. Rs.
The state-run telecom company had also reported an increase in its losses to about Rs 88.50 billion during 2011-12 due to regulatory expenses and non-receipt of funds for its rural landlines operations.
